Homogeneous catalysis of electrochemical reactions. Channel electrode voltammetry and the EC′ mechanism
The shape of the current-voltage curves at a channel electrode have been calculated for the various situations of the catalytic (EC’) mechanism. In particular the halfwave potential and limiting current are found to be highly sensitive to the solution-flow rate and to the concentrations of the media...
